Question What the heck is wrong with me?

Ok, here is the deal. I have a 2002 gt, Pullys, Intake, 75mm TB, Predator Tune, MAC H-Pipe, Flowmasters, 4.10 gears, 1.5" lowerd, Tri-Axe Shifter. Some ok MODS. I ran a 13.7 without the Pullys and the TB. I moved and now run on a 1/8 mile track. My best time is 9.1 What the hell is wrong with me. If im not mistaken i should be in the mid 8's. I did get new tires for my 18x9 cobras but i dont know if thats why im sucking. IM running PRoxies right now. As you all know with 4.10s and street tires tracktion is non-existent, but im not a bad driver. Someone give me an idea on what my problem is.


I also hear that elevation changes your time? Is this true? If so what kind of change would you need to mess up a time like what is happening to me. Id think it would need to be a big change.

Was 13.7 your absolute best run? You should proabably use an average of your better runs to do your calculating. Also, what did your average timeslips say your 1/8 mile time was? You may have been picking up alot of time in the second half of the 1/4 and so running a 9.1 would seem slow, but if you continued to a full 1/4 your time wouldn't be so bad. I'm not much a drag racer and stick to AutoX, so I don't know what your times should be with your mods or how 1/8 times usually relate to 1/4 times. Track prep, the tires, ect. all make a difference.
